In this course, learners will study the graphs of polynomials and how they relate to their algebraic properties. Beginning with a deep study of the power functions, the course builds up through transformations of power functions into an intuitive study of the graphs of polynomials. Next, learn about the roots of polynomials and how they connect to factors of the polynomials. Finally, dive into special polynomial factorization problems.
